Multiple Immune Factors Are Involved in Controlling Acute and Chronic Chikungunya Virus Infection
The recent epidemic of the arthritogenic alphavirus, chikungunya virus (CHIKV) has prompted a quest to understand the correlates of protection against virus and disease in order to inform development of new interventions.
